WTMG’s Leo Faria: “I ended up enjoying this particular preview build of Dead Island 2. It didnt bother me with its open world design, despite being released during a time where said level structure isnt impressive anymore. Its story is indeed interesting, its setting is amazing (a zombie-ridden California? Sign me in!), its performance was stunning. Its just the weak combat and overly Buzzfeed-y vibe that bothered me, with the latter simply not mixing well with an apocalyptic setting. I am still looking forward to play the final release, slated for April 21st, 2023. I cant believe that the damn thing is finally seeing the light of day.”
